Thu Nov 07 03:10:00 UTC 2024: ## Dingell Wins Re-election in Michigan’s 6th Congressional District
**Ann Arbor, MI** – Democratic incumbent Debbie Dingell has secured another two-year term representing Michigan’s 6th Congressional District, defeating Republican challenger Heather Smiley. With nearly all votes counted, Dingell garnered 62% of the vote, while Smiley received 35%.
Dingell, who first won the seat in 2014, has made a name for herself through her legislative work, including passing bills addressing PFAS contamination and extending funding for home-based care for older Americans.
The 6th District encompasses a diverse range of communities, stretching from the Detroit River around Grosse Ile to the Chelsea area and north to Canton.
